MP3: Hari and Aino - Finland
Therese is spot-on in Atrap.com/reviews.php?r=782">her assessment of Hari and Aino. Comparisons to early Cardigans are unavoidable as they both feAture a female-fronted lineup with a similar sweet, cocktail party pop sound and easy-going vibe, though I do disagree about the best song -- "Finland" wins it for me with it's light disco feel and subtle rhythmic intricacy. However, we both agree it's a bit on the restrained side. I understand they're after a very clean, refined sound, but I don't think a little extra excitement would get in the way. As is, it's perfectly pleasant and undemanding. The Cardigans always took more chances, still do in fact. As nice as this is, nice doesn't win.

Hari and Aino
s/t
Plastilina Records
To me, Andrea Dahlkild, lead vocals in Hari and Aino, is a blend between Duffy, Maja Ivarsson and Nina Persson. She is edgy in a sophisticAted & balanced way. I ain't eager to go to one of their shows since I don't think thAt will be needed to change my impression. The Cardigans are not a secretly professional band, but it sometimes falls flAt; Hari and Aino reminds me of thAt. You know when there is a possibility to listen too much of something effecting in sickness to your ears. The album withholds 10 songs, a perfect number! This is sweet indie pop, not cocky, political, heartbreaking songs; no, we are talking about a hint of shyness and pulsAting sympAthetic music thAt are feeding your hungry music veins. Finland apparently has a big influence on them (see "Finland") and I really have to ask them why; going on talking about their other songs, I must say thAt "Seasons" is causing good vibrAtions and is unquestionably their best hit. Also, I recommend "Your heartache and mine". This Stockholm based band has very good potential, I just want them get wild here and there, to surprise. I wish them my best and think y'all out there should give this little twee beautiful album a listen.
- Therese Buxfäldt
